I'm using Davinci Resolve 16 on a late 2013 Macbook Pro (Big Sur) and if I deliver a 720p project using the "H.264 Master" profile with mostly default settings (apart from burning subtitles into the video) then the resulting file plays OK on Intel Macbooks but doesn't play correctly on a new Macbook Air M1 - the audio plays OK but the video framerate is about 1 fps. Also, it caused iMovie to crash.

I've made a short 20s test export that exhibits the problem but it seems I'm not allowed to post a link to it here.

Any idea what might be causing this or how to avoid it? I also tried enabling two-pass encoding and setting the bitrate to 2000 kbps but it didn't help.

I asked the owner of the Macbook Air M1 to install VLC and try playing the file with that and VLC plays it fine so the finger of blame is pointing at the codecs built in to macOS for the M1.

Raise it to Apple, I can confirm that it doesn't play here on M1, while it plays fine on an Intel Mac.

What I noticed is the 3.1 profile, try to encode to 4.1.
